Output dd61fe2436980988494c0a549651fe5320c6226598bf8959caee88e48a3eddf7:0

value
45139
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7615db79aa95905c9aa1e14cd4a6b764b716c701a8a3bb6c7aab2ac56f4601bc
address
bc1pwc2ak7d2jkg9ex4pu9xdff4hvjm3d3cp4z3mkmr64v4v2m6xqx7qwkuant
transaction
dd61fe2436980988494c0a549651fe5320c6226598bf8959caee88e48a3eddf7